AAE Error 9416 is a relatively rare but persistent Pro Tools error often linked to processing or general system resource strain . While Avid hasn't officially listed it in all standard documentation, community consensus and recent reports from 2025 identify it as a "mystery error" that can occur even when EA is not explicitly active.
